| | Fire Giants I am having a problem with the fire giants when you first enter Yaga-Shura's temple. There are like 7 of them. As soon as I enter, I die. How do I beat them? I am a mage PC, without any level 9 spells. |

| | Invisibility RULES!!!
Those fire giants don't have any mages/clerics when you enter to cast true sight so just go invisible. Choose your battleground then kill them off.
I usually choose the room just to the left of the entrance. Position a protected from fire, high hitpoints and low AC character blocking the door there so you only deal with ONE giant at a time. The rest use missile weapons. Nice that the giants DON'T use missile weapons.

| | Yes, what jeremiah said. Just cast Invisibility 10' Radius before entering and go to the room on the left. I think there is one giant in that room (should be easy to finish one), and when the other giants come for you, block the entrance to the room so that only one can attack at a time.
There might be a big enough gap between the other giants so that you can actually rest before taking the last few on.
